Frequently Asked Questions

How long does restorative work last?

With good care, crowns and bridges typically last 10-15+ years, fillings 5-10+ years, and dentures 5-10 years before needing relining or replacement.

Can you do restorative work the same day as my emergency visit?

Often yes, especially for fillings, bonding, extractions, and denture repairs. Crowns and root canals may take one or two follow-up visits depending on the case.

Do you use tooth-colored materials?

Yes. Our standard fillings are composite (tooth-colored), and our crowns use porcelain or porcelain-fused-to-metal depending on the tooth.
